Position Summary:

Healthcare Assistants (Camp Nurse Assistants) are responsible for assisting the Healthcare Supervisor in overseeing the health and well-being standards for the camp population and facilities in our Girl Scout residential camp setting. The position also assists in the management of camper and staff health and safety through applying daily first-aid treatments, monitoring necessary medications, maintaining records, and logging injuries. Due to close contact and overnight supervision of a Girl Scout youth population in a residential setting, Healthcare Assistants must be female.

The Healthcare Assistant position is limited to one per week. Healthcare Assistants may assist with 1-4 weeks of Summer Camp, based on Summer Camp needs and individual availability. 

 

Key Responsibilities:

  • Review inventory of necessary medical supplies and equipment at the beginning and end of each camp week assigned.
  • Monitor health care plans, maintain records, and resolve any emergencies as necessary.
  • Assist in the completion of camper and staff health screening upon arrival, departure, and during the summer, including: 
    • Verification of health history and examination 
    • Verification of emergency authorization 
    • History of recent exposure to communicable disease 
    • Review of the CCSC policies for the collection, storage, and administration of medications 
    • General health assessment, including lice and ring worm check 
  • Maintain accurate and detailed medical records for campers and staff, including: 
    • Health forms, with special attention to immunization compliance 
    • Health Center Log of daily clinic visits 
    • Charts for Health Center In-patients 
    • Progress notes for campers and staff with complex health issues 
    • Daily reports of restricted activities for campers and staff 
    • Medication Administration Records 
    • Incident Report forms 
  • Research and contact health resources in the community as needed by campers and staff.
  • Communicate between camper families and physicians as needed, when the healthcare supervisor is absent. 
  • Review emergency procedures with Camp Manager before the start of camp.
  • Abide by GSHPA code of conduct, rules, and expectations. 
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
